Hi Again tidy_trax,
This hasnt worked, I got flooded off
lol.
Here is my understanding of what you posted, which is most likely completly wrong heh!
alias checkall {
;Declare %i and set it to 1
var %i 1
;here is where I'm stumped
;to me it appears as
;while ( nick 1 isin the #channel ) { do stuff }
while $nick(#channel,%i) {
;the 'stuff' to do, set a timer as someones nick
;+ 1, i.e. timerjoe 1
/timer [ $+ [ $nick ] ] 1
;then give result of multiplying %i by 15?
$calc(%i *15)
;then do my check ( a whois) on nick 1 on #channel
yourcheck $nick(#channel,%i)
;then increase %i by 1
}
I know im missing brackets etc but I wanted to break it down like that to see if I am getting it right. I have edited the above and placed it in the remote section as follows:
alias check {
var %i 1
while $nick( #, %i ) { timer [ $+ [ $nick ] ] 1
$calc(%i *15) whois $nick( #, %i ) }
inc %i
}
I have left it as # on purpose so I can run it in any channel, but I got a whole heap of timers (ctrl+break that!) and then flooded off once I stopped them.
If you could break down the examples as I have done I would appreciate it.
Thanks again for the help
Dizkonnekted